Understanding the Concept of a Prop Firm

Before diving into the specifics of starting a prop firm, it is essential to grasp the fundamental concept. A proprietary trading firm, or prop firm, is a company that uses its own capital to engage in financial market trading. Unlike traditional investment firms that manage client funds, a prop firm invests its own money and compensates traders through profit-sharing models. This structure allows for greater flexibility, risk management control, and profit potential.

Step-by-Step Process of How to Start a Prop Firm

1. Conduct Market Research and Define Your Niche

The first crucial phase involves thorough market analysis. Understand existing prop firms' operational models, identify gaps, and determine your own niche. Do you want to specialize in equities, forex, commodities, or algorithmic trading? Recognizing your target market and competitive edge is vital. Research current trends, trader demands, and regulatory landscapes to inform your direction.

2. Develop a Solid Business Plan

A comprehensive business plan outlines your company's vision, target audience, capital requirements, operational structure, revenue models, and risk management strategies. Include detailed financial projections, marketing strategies, staff needs, and compliance plans. A well-crafted plan serves as your roadmap and is essential for securing funding or partnerships.

3. Legal Structures, Licensing, and Regulatory Compliance

Establishing a legal entity—such as an LLC or corporation—is the next step. Consult legal experts to navigate licensing requirements, especially if your jurisdiction mandates financial regulatory approvals. Adherence to local, national, and international regulations, including anti-money laundering (AML) and know-your-customer (KYC) policies, is non-negotiable. Compliance not only ensures legitimacy but also builds trust with traders and investors.

4. Secure Adequate Capital

Starting a prop firm requires sufficient capital to fund traders and cover operational costs. Whether you self-fund, seek angel investors, or venture capital, ensure you have enough liquidity to support your initial trading activities and risk buffers. It’s prudent to maintain a reserve to withstand market fluctuations and unexpected expenses.

5. Establish Technological Infrastructure

In the digital age, robust trading technology is the backbone of a successful prop firm. Invest in reliable trading platforms, risk management software, secure data servers, and communication systems. Consider developing or licensing proprietary trading tools, analytics dashboards, and automated strategies that give your traders an edge while maintaining control.

6. Recruit and Train Talented Traders

Your traders are the core of your prop firm. Recruit talented individuals with proven track records, discipline, and strategic thinking. Implement thorough evaluation processes, such as trading simulations or funded challenges. Offer ongoing training, mentorship, and access to cutting-edge resources to foster continuous improvement and loyalty.

7. Design Attractive Funding and Profit-Sharing Models

Structuring your profit-sharing and funding models is critical to attract and retain top traders. Common models include fixed percentage splits, tiered profit-sharing, or performance-based incentives. Transparency and fairness in these arrangements help build trust and motivation among your trading team.

8. Implement Rigorous Risk Management Protocols

Effective risk management safeguards your capital and ensures sustainability. Set strict trading limits, drawdown thresholds, and leverage controls. Employ real-time risk monitoring systems and have clear policies for trade audits, violations, and dispute resolutions. Embedding these practices creates a disciplined trading environment.

9. Establish Operational and Administrative Processes

From onboarding traders to compliance checks and financial reporting, establish clear operational procedures. Use automation where possible to streamline processes, reduce errors, and improve efficiency. Hire skilled administrative personnel or partner with firms offering back-office services, ensuring your operations run smoothly.
